Troubleshooting NIC Issues

If you're experiencing issues with NIC, try these troubleshooting steps:

Basic Steps

  • 1. Verify your internet connection. Ensure you have a stable, active connection by loading a non-NIC website (like a search engine) in a separate browser tab. If that fails, restart your router or switch to a wired connection.
  • 2. Refresh the NIC portal aggressively. NIC pages can be cached by your browser or ISP. Perform a hard refresh using Ctrl + F5 (Windows) or Cmd + Shift + R (Mac) to bypass the local cache and request the latest server response.
  • 3. Clear browser cookies and site data for NIC. Stale authentication tokens or session cookies can block page loading. Clear your browser's cache and cookies for the last hour or all time, then restart your browser before reattempting access.
  • 4. Try a different browser or an incognito window. Extensions (pop-up blockers, privacy tools) often interfere with government sites. Test NIC in a default incognito/private window with all extensions disabled to isolate the issue.
  • 5. Disable VPN or proxy services temporarily. NIC frequently restricts traffic from known VPN IP ranges. Turn off any active VPN, Smart DNS, or corporate proxy, then attempt to load the site directly.

Intermediate Steps

  • 1. Check for Java/Plugin dependencies. Several NIC applications (like e-Office, PFMS, or GSTN portals) require specific Java versions or browser plugins. If a specific NIC subdomain shows a blank page or a certificate error, verify that your Java runtime is up to date (version 8 or 11) and that the Java plugin is enabled for the site.
  • 2. Perform a DNS flush and change your DNS server. NIC's national infrastructure often has slow DNS propagation. Flush your DNS cache (run ipconfig /flushdns in Command Prompt) and temporarily switch your DNS to a public resolver (like Google DNS 8.8.8.8 or Cloudflare 1.1.1.1) to rule out ISP-level DNS failures.
  • 3. Test during off-peak hours. NIC servers are heavily loaded between 9 AM and 5 PM IST, especially on financial portals. If you're seeing timeouts, try accessing the service after 8 PM or on weekends to distinguish between server overload and a true outage.
  • 4. Check your system's date/time and TLS settings. Many NIC pages use certificate pinning. If your device clock is off by more than a few minutes, SSL handshakes will fail. Also, ensure that TLS 1.2 is enabled in your browser's advanced settings, as NIC has deprecated older protocols.
